Friday, I purchased sufficient Basswood to plank the solid hull of Bluejackets 1/96 USS Constitution. The web price was $45, but when I called to order the price had doubled to $90 plus $10 bucks shipping. Quantity was 100 pieces 3/32x24x.20. Is that out of line with the market??? Fortunately, I had purchased the copper plates several years. If they double as well, that will make them around $450. I understand now why rolls of thin copper strip have replaced individual copper tiles, but some of the best rolled copper has been discontinued by 3M and is only available on the secondary market at a 300% mark-up. Bluejacket's Connie is now over a Grand if you want to plank it, and copper plate it.
Yes, their is a reason why kit costs are going up.........
